The Model 29-5 Classic represents the endurance-package era, with internal durability enhancements and longer cylinder-stop notches that align with S&W’s -5 updates. This example is a pre-lock configuration and was produced in the early 1990s in the USA.
Its 6.5 inch full-underlug barrel with a serrated rib provides the classic 29 profile, and the interchangeable front-sight base currently wears a green fiber-optic blade. A micrometer-adjustable rear sight supports precise elevation and windage adjustments.
The double-action/single-action system is paired with a wide, smooth-faced trigger and an exposed hammer for confident control. Capacity is six rounds.
Construction is blued carbon steel for the frame/receiver with a blued steel cylinder. Markings include “MOD. 29-5” on the crane cut and “29 Classic” and “.44 Magnum” on the barrel. A T-prefix serial range aligns with early 1990s production, and assembly number “325” is observed inside the frame window. The revolver is chambered in .44 Rem Magnum and also accepts .44 Special.
